As a part of this series, I had the pleasure of interviewing Justin Waltz.

Justin Waltz has been Brand President of The Junkluggers since January 2024. With over a decade of experience in junk removal and franchise operations, he has held significant roles at 1–800-GOT-JUNK and College HUNKS Hauling Junk & Moving®, where he showcased his skills in business growth and sustainability. At The Junkluggers, he is dedicated to strengthening relationships with franchise owners, expanding the brand’s national footprint, driving technological innovation, and upholding the brand’s commitment to environmental responsibility and community impact.

Can you share an example of how your work with AI has had a meaningful impact (on others, on business results, etc.)? What was the situation, and what difference did it make?

First and foremost, AI has revolutionized The Junkluggers’ operations, particularly for our franchise owners. Think bigger picture — running a home service franchise requires more than just trade skills. Franchise owners must be able to manage a variety of administrative tasks too, like paperwork and inventory. AI has streamlined our processes, such as screening phone calls and categorizing customers based on their needs. These tasks can streamline backend operations, allowing owners to focus on other important aspects of their businesses like staffing, taking on additional jobs, and delivering exceptional service. Overall, we’ve seen significant benefits from adopting AI, even boosting appointment conversions by 25%.

Secondly, AI helps us to enhance customer services and capture data. The technology we’ve integrated helps our owners improve data management, making it easier to capture, organize, and analyze customer information. While AI is beneficial for inputting details on new customers, it can also double-check and organize existing data. Because of its ability to capture and update data, our AI technology has significantly reduced our customer handle time and has helped eliminate scheduling inefficiencies. Many franchises are finding traditional methods of managing customer and financial data, like spreadsheets, are time-consuming and becoming outdated, so adopting AI-powered systems have helped streamline the billing and invoicing processes. This has reduced inefficiencies and allowed our teams to focus on delivering exceptional service.

Here is the main question for our discussion. Based on your experience and success, can you please share “Five Things You Need To Know To Help Shape The Future of AI”? (Please share a story or an example, for each.)

Understanding the Implications — There are a lot of AI tools out there. While some can seem fun, many are still in the early stages of development and many users are just learning how to use them. When looking into AI, make sure to go in with clarity on its purpose and potential.

Integrating Technologies — With so many tools available, it’s important to get those you do use working together effectively. For instance, a single AI-driven system with 50 capabilities can often be more efficient and cost-effective than juggling multiple fragmented tools that each offer limited solutions. I believe the future of AI will focus on bridging these gaps, creating systems where fragmented tools communicate effortlessly to deliver comprehensive, streamlined solutions.

Defining Use Cases — Without clear application examples, people may remain skeptical of AI or unsure about adopting it. Providing teachable moments and accessible resources helps the technology seem more approachable.

Master the Basics — For those looking to just get started, check out sources like ChatGPT, Claude or Gemin. Experiment with different prompts to get a feel for the programs and use cases to build confidence. You will make progress so fast!

Adopt a Solution-Oriented Mindset — In business, automation and connectivity are key. Entrepreneurs must look to AI as a way to improve processes, connect with customers and unlock growth opportunities. Don’t be afraid of it!
